KARACHI, July 17: Acts of targeted killing continued in the city as five more people, including a worker each of the Awami National Party, Muttahida Qaumi Movement and Jamaat-i-Islami, were killed on Tuesday.
A local leader of the Awami National Party, identified as Fazal Ameen, 40, was gunned down in a targeted attack in Sherpao Colony.
Police said the victim was checking his car’s radiator when at least two men riding a motorcycle fired at him.
The victim suffered multiple gunshot wounds and died shortly afterwards. His body was taken to the Jinnah Postgraduate Medical Centre for an autopsy and later his body was moved to his hometown of Mardan for burial.
A large number of ANP workers also reached the JPMC and shouted slogans against the assassination.
Quaidabad police station SHO Amanullah Marwat said the victim was associated with cargo business. The motive for the killing was not yet clear, he added.
Following the incident, routine and commercial activities were also suspended in the locality while heavy contingents of Rangers and police were deployed to prevent any untoward incident.
Muttahida worker
A worker of the Muttahida Qaumi Movement was gunned down by unknown persons in Baldia Town.
Police said Aqeel was targeted by the assailants in Qaimkhani Colony, within the remit of the Baldia police station.Police said Aqeel was standing near his home when unknown suspects riding a motorcycle fired at him.
He was taken to a nearby hospital, where he was pronounced dead. The body was shifted to the Civil Hospital Karachi for medico-legal formalities.
Following the incident tension prevailed in the area and routine and commercial activities were suspended.
Law-enforcement agencies said the victim worked in a factory and was associated with the MQM’s unit 112. The police, however, said they were trying to ascertain the motive for the killing.
JI local leader
A member of the Jamaat-i-Islami was gunned down by unknown persons in New Karachi.
Police said the incident took place in Sector 5J near Amir Autos, where gunmen riding a motorcycle targeted Abdul Rasheed, 26. Area people took the wounded to the Abbasi Shaheed Hospital, where he died during treatment, the police said.
They said Rasheed was the New Karachi Nazim of the JI. At the time of the attack, he was standing near his home. The dead was associated with garment business, the police said.
Other killings
A man was shot dead by unknown persons in the Manghopir area.
Police said Saifullah, 35, was gunned down in an act of targeted killing at Bhutto Mor in Manghopir.
Police officials said the victim, a massager, was sitting at a barbershop when unidentified men shot and killed him.
Pirabad police station SHO said the victim lived in Sultanabad and hailed from southern Punjab while the motive for the crime was not clear.
The body was shifted to the Civil Hospital Karachi for medico-legal formalities.
Another man was killed by unknown persons in Nazimabad.
Police said the incident took place in Nazimabad where Altaf, 42, son of Ghulam Ghaus, was killed within the remit of the Shamim Shaheed police post.
The police said he was killed allegedly by his business partner Saleem over a monetary dispute. They claimed to have arrested the suspect and were investigating the matter.
In what police described as an incident of personal enmity, Rehmatullah was killed by his rivals who were also reported to be seriously wounded in the crossfire that took place within the remit of the Orangi Town police station, said SSP of District West Amir Farooqui.
In the Mawach Goth police limits, an unidentified man was wounded in what police described as a snatching attempt. The victim was rushed to the Civil Hospital Karachi, where he was pronounced dead on arrival.
